Affordable Care Act – Summary of Benefits and Coverage

Requests Must Be Submitted to Change Summary of Benefits and Coverage
The Summary of Benefits and Coverage (SBC) provision of the Affordable Care Act requires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Illinois (BCBSIL) to use a government-developed template and to follow specific rules when creating SBCs. Because BCBSIL may be responsible for the accuracy of the SBCs, we do not allow any unauthorized changes to any portion of the document or to any elements in the document, including logos or fonts. If a change is necessary, BCBSIL must make it.

Generally, the only information that BCBSIL will routinely customize are the “Coverage Period” (dates) and “Coverage For” (e.g., individual or family) sections at the top right on Page 1. Follow these steps to request a change to these sections:

  • Contact the Summary of Benefits and Coverage Hotline at 855-756-4448.
  • Provide the Corporate ID (for example,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Illinois) and Plan ID for the requested SBC.
  • Communicate the item(s) that needs to be changed (“Coverage Period” and/or “Coverage For”) and the new information.
  • Provide an email address for delivery of the updated SBC.

Always retrieve SBCs from the SBC Tool (https://ha.pivot.rrd.com) to ensure that you have the most current and accurate SBC.
